About This Item

Cantabridgiae [Cambridge, Massachusetts]: Academiae Typographorum, Typis Metcalf et Sociorum, 1857. In Latin. Published 1857. Handsomely bound copy of this record of Harvard students, faculty and alumni, with the alumni listing starting in 1642 and continuing through the publication date. Full crimson morocco leather with gilt spine lettering and decorated compartments, additional decoration in blind, slightly raised spine bands, marbled endpapers, 144 pages plus a 44 page index. Original wraps bound in. Book has the naval-themed personal bookplate of Theodore Winthrop Steadman (born in Shanghai, China; graduated from Harvard in 1933; with residences in Farmington, Connecticut and Fishers Island, New York at the time of his death in 2006) on the front pastedown. Very light rubbing to the covers, red color and gilt bright and unfaded, good hinges, firm text block, pages age-toned but clean, old archival repair to original front cover, coffee-colored stains to the outer margins of the first few pages, pages otherwise clean and unmarked.. Hard Cover. Very Good.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all.
